Default Codecs, codecs, codecs :-/

Hi folks,

I joined this forum because my knowledge regarding video editing on PC's is very limited and I'd love to know more. At the weekend myself and a friend recorded a short amount of video and quickly compiled it into an editing avi file.

Basically a situation arose which confuses me. I edited the movie on my friends machine and used one of the MPEG 4 codec installed on his machine. When I got the video's home I could play them all fine on my machine BUT, I then went to fiddle around and edit a bit more so I opened up premier and upon trying to open the files I received an error which I perceived as a usual "no codec" error (I cant remember the exact text so I don't want to potentially mislead people). Does this scenario make sense to anybody? I always assumed if you can play it, you can open it for editing, but obviously not :
